Wedding photography essentials embody a range of methods, instruments, and considerations that type the foundation of capturing one of the most vital days in a couple’s life. Understanding these essentials is essential for each novice and skilled photographers aiming to ship stunning memories that couples will cherish eternally.


First and foremost, having the right gear is important for wedding photography. A high-quality digicam and an array of lenses fitted to numerous conditions must be on the agenda. A quick lens, for instance, is particularly useful for low-light environments such as reception venues. A versatile zoom lens may also be invaluable as it allows the photographer to capture intimate moments from a distance with out intruding on the ceremony.

Lighting performs an integral role in wedding photography. Often, ceremonies happen in environments with challenging lighting situations, similar to darkish church buildings or outside settings with harsh daylight. Investing in good quality exterior flashes and reflectors might help manipulate mild to achieve the desired impact. Understanding natural and artificial lighting can be key to ensuring every shot is completely lit.


Planning ahead is one other crucial facet of wedding photography. A pre-wedding session with the couple might help determine specific shots they want and places which may be significant to them. Creating a shot listing ensures that no important moment is missed, from the first look to the slicing of the cake. Familiarizing oneself with the marriage timeline may help photographers anticipate pivotal moments.

Capturing candid moments is a trademark of wonderful wedding photography. While posed shots certainly have their place, capturing feelings and interactions as they unfold tells a more real story of the day. Observing the interactions between friends, the laughter, and the tears creates a narrative that displays the essence of the event.


Post-processing is an space that shouldn’t be overlooked. While capturing beautiful images is crucial, editing plays an equally essential position in enhancing those images. Software such as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op may help modify lighting, appropriate colors, and add that special contact to every photograph, making them evocative and polished. Creating a cohesive look throughout the whole assortment of photographs helps in storytelling.


Preparing for various eventualities is part of being a profitable wedding photographer. Expect the surprising, whether it’s inclement climate or last-minute schedule changes. Being adaptable and creative within the face of surprises permits photographers to still ship stunning and compelling images. Being mentally ready for such contingencies also instills confidence when navigating the day.

Communication with the couple and their households is crucial throughout the marriage day. Building rapport helps ease nerves, making the subjects feel extra comfy in front of the lens. This comfort interprets to extra natural-looking photos. Moreover, being assertive in guiding groups during formal poses may help streamline the photography course of.


Editing and delivering the final photographs is the final stage of the photographic journey. It’s essential to be aware of the couple's preferences relating to how they want to receive their images. Offering numerous packages that embrace digital downloads, prints, or even albums allows the couple to select what best suits their wants. Timeliness is key on this side; couples appreciate a quick turnaround.


Additional issues may embrace the sort of photography types the couple prefers. Some may lean towards conventional photography, specializing in posed portraits and traditional setups. Others may favor a documentary type, emphasizing storytelling via raw, unfiltered moments. Understanding these preferences can information photographers in producing a tailor-made expertise.

  • Utilize a second shooter to capture different angles and moments, ensuring no essential detail is missed throughout the day.

  • Invest in a quality lens for low-light performance, especially necessary for indoor ceremonies and night receptions.

  • Create a detailed shot list in collaboration with the couple to guarantee all desired moments and family portraits are captured effectively.

  • Incorporate a mix of candid and posed pictures to replicate the genuine feelings and interactions all through the marriage day.

  • Plan for backup gear, similar to further batteries and memory playing cards, to keep away from any technical failures in the course of the occasion.

  • Scout the venue prematurely to determine the most effective areas for pictures, taking notice of lighting circumstances and potential backgrounds.

  • Engage with guests to create a relaxed atmosphere, making it easier to seize genuine moments with out stiff poses.

  • Respect the couple's most well-liked photography fashion, whether it's traditional, documentary, or inventive, to keep up consistency throughout the album.

  • Coordinate with the marriage planner to align photography timings with vital events like speeches, cake cutting, and first dances.

The perfect time for wedding portraits is often through the "golden hour," which happens shortly before sunset. This time provides delicate, flattering light that enhances pores and skin tones and creates a romantic ambiance. Plan for about an hour for portraits to ensure ample time for numerous poses and settings.
